    [NT 15003449]: Part I: World Preview -- Chapter 1. Diabetic-Foot Complications in Asian & European Continents -- Chapter 2. Diabetic-Foot Complications in African and Antarctica Continents -- Chapter 3. Diabetic-Foot Complications in American and Australian Continents -- Part II: Complications & Treatments Updates -- Chapter 4. Acute and Chronic Wound Healing Physiology -- Chapter 5. Screening of Foot Inflammation in Diabetic Patients by Non-invasive Imaging Modalities -- Chapter 6. Molecular Mechanism & BioMechanics of the Diabetic Foot: The Road to Foot Ulceration and Healing -- Chapter 7. Foot Pressure Abnormalities, Radiographic and Charcot Changes in the Diabetic Foot -- Chapter 8. Aerobic and Anaerobic Bacterial Infections and Treatment Strategies -- Chapter 9. MRSA, EBSL and Biofilm formation in Diabetic Foot Ulcer Infections -- Chapter 10. Fungal infection: the hidden enemy? -- Chapter 11. Diabetic Foot Syndrome: Risk Factors, Clinical Assessment, and Advances in Diagnosis -- Part III Developments, Future prospective, New Possible Treatments -- Chapter 12. Advances in Prevention and Empirical Treatment of Diabetic Foot Infection -- Chapter 13. Prevention of Diabetic Foot: Indian Experience -- Chapter 14. Low Cost Management in Diabetic Foot -- Chapter 15. Role of Growth Factors in the Treatment of Diabetic Foot Ulceration -- Chapter 16. Stem cells in the Treatment of Diabetic Foot Ulcers -- Chapter 17. Alternative Medicine in the Management of Diabetic Foot Ulcers/Infections -- Chapter 18. Modern Phytomedicine in Treating Diabetic Foot Ulcer: Progress and Opportunities -- Chapter 19. Management of Diabetic Foot Ulcer by Hirudo medicinalis, the 'healing leech' -- Chapter 20. Nanotechnology and Diabetic Foot Ulcer: Future prospects.
